Gymnastics at the 2012 Summer Olympics – Women's rhythmic group all-around

The group competition in rhythmic gymnastics at the 2012 Olympic Games in London was held at Wembley Arena from 9 to 12 August 2012. A total of 72 athletes competed.

The competition consisted of a qualifying round and the final. Each team entered in both qualifying and the finals twice with five gymnasts. The first time was gymnastics with five balls, the second demonstration took place with three ribbons and two hoops. The two ratings were added to a final grade. The top eight teams qualified for the final.
